About the role
We’re looking for an experienced Assistant Contracts Manager to join our Civil Engineering team and help lead the successful delivery of Breedon’s framework contracts and individual projects across the Western and Southern Region.
This is a varied and influential role with responsibility across the full lifecycle of our civil engineering works — from scoping, planning and programming through to operational delivery, commercial performance and client management.
You’ll lead a small team of Contracts Supervisors and Engineers, coordinate multiple projects at the same time and work closely with our clients and wider Breedon teams to ensure every project is delivered safely, efficiently, to a high standard and with strong commercial performance.
You’ll take ownership of the day-to-day management and performance of the contracts and projects under your control.
